Transaction 589ea25efc4e9b7ca8a0687ed7a9448c2b037eb215e5088a0e688ad5f0921e21
1 Input
1 Output
-
589ea25efc4e9b7ca8a0687ed7a9448c2b037eb215e5088a0e688ad5f0921e21:0
- value
- 24409
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8eaecf33b0adf89e0c29a1e96324f2d462e8278d OP_EQUAL
- address
- 3EhTHkbffmXRCHzTf9i76ZUfDRq3CG2Dsi